Transaction 1933113cafb9e7083ec8b1403561647554669295c4096f76d0403050ac74609e

2 Input
3 Outputs
  • 1933113cafb9e7083ec8b1403561647554669295c4096f76d0403050ac74609e:0
  • value  1500000
    address  12r4MzARafBkmZnMzR3ocV6umrejvi9DkH
  • 1933113cafb9e7083ec8b1403561647554669295c4096f76d0403050ac74609e:1
  • value  88995659
    address  1CtYjrW9DmQSP2VAh5BLB57JYHg92Z5wbo
  • 1933113cafb9e7083ec8b1403561647554669295c4096f76d0403050ac74609e:2
  • value  2619620
    address  1DmURujzzMAYqpUWXiDwdELWTBFw86foYd